Part 4 — Judgments and Writs Division 1 Registration
34 Subordination of subsequent interests
other enactment, an interest acquired in property after the property
is bound by a writ is subordinate to the writ.
(2) Where an interest in property is subordinate to a writ,

(a) the property is subject to writ proceedings to the same extent
that the property would have been if the subordinate interest
did not exist, and
(b) a person who acquires the property as a result of writ
proceedings acquires the property free of the subordinate
interest.
